                         EXCEL COMMUNICATIONS ANNOUNCES
                          BURNS AND LUKEN RESIGNATION
                                        
     Dallas - Excel Communications, Inc.  (NYSE: ECI) today announced the
resignation of Donald A. Burns and Henry G. Luken III from its board of
directors and the Company.

     Burns and Luken joined the Board earlier this year at the completion of
Excel's merger with Telco Communications Group to facilitate the integration of
the two operations.  Both Burns and Luken had been with Telco since its
formation in 1993, and although both individuals plan to pursue other interests,
they will continue to work with Excel on a consulting basis.

     "Don and Henry have been an integral part of our operations during the past
few months to insure a seamless transition," said John J.  McLaine, Excel
president and chief operating officer. "They have both made significant
contributions to the Company in a relatively short period of time."

     Dallas-based Excel Communications, Inc. is the fifth largest long distance
company in the United States. The Company offers its subscribers a variety of
communications products and services which include residential service,
commercial service, paging service, dial-around service and calling cards. Excel
presubscribed residential and commercial services are marketed exclusively
through a nationwide network of Independent Representatives. Excel markets its
residential dial around products and services through Dial and Save(SM), Long
Distance Wholesale Club(SM) and Telco Choice(SM) programs and markets its
commercial products and services through 450 sales representatives located in 31
regional offices in 16 states. Excel has more than 3,000 employees who support
the corporate, network management, billing, teleservices and marketing functions
of the Company.
